Last updated 6 October.The University of Kansas Natural History Museum is part of the University of Kansas Biodiversity Institute, a KU designated research center dedicated to the study of the life of the planet. The museum's galleries are in Dyche Hall on the university's main campus in Lawrence, Kansas. LAWRENCE — The University of Kansas Natural History Museum, part of the KU Biodiversity Institute, will reopen to the public Thursday, May 6. Public hours will be 1-5 p.m. Tuesday through Saturday. The two-story Theodore Roosevelt Memorial includes the Museum’s Central Park West entrance, the Theodore Roosevelt Rotunda, and the Theodore Roosevelt Memorial Hall.. … Lawrence natural history museum, Book your tickets online for Biodiversity Institute and Natural History Museum, Lawrence: See 117 reviews, articles, and 44 photos of Biodiversity Institute and Natural History Museum, ranked No.5 on Tripadvisor among 48 attractions in Lawrence., Lawrence is a city in and the county seat of Douglas County, Kansas, United States, and the sixth-largest city in the state. It is in the northeastern sector of the state, astride Interstate 70, between the Kansas and Wakarusa Rivers. As of the 2020 census, the population of the city was 94,934. Archaeology is the study of past human cultures. Through the analysis of material remains recovered from archaeological sites, archaeologists are able to reconstruct past lifeways, behaviors, and adaptations, often through an interdisciplinary approach. While most of Kansas was covered by a shallow sea 110 million years ago, dense forests along the eastern coast were home to the dinosaur Silvisaurus.
